S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

Background

    The Department's regulations provide that the Secretary will 
publish in the Federal Register a list of scope rulings on a quarterly 
basis. See 19 C.F.R. 351.225(o). Our most recent notification of scope 
rulings was published on May 22, 2008. See Notice of Scope Rulings, 73 
FR 29739 (May 22, 2008). This current notice covers all scope rulings 
and anticircumvention determinations completed by Import Administration 
between April 1, 2008, and June 30, 2008, inclusive, and it also lists 
any scope or anticircumvention inquiries pending as of June 30, 2008. 
As described below, subsequent lists will follow after the close of 
each calendar quarter.

Scope Rulings Completed Between April 1, 2008, and June 30, 2008:

People's Republic of China

A-570-868: Folding Metal Tables and Chairs from the People's Republic 
of China

Requestor: Ignite USA, LLC; the VIKA Twofold 2-in-1 Workbench/Scaffold 
is not within the scope of the antidumping duty order; April 18, 2008.

A-570-890: Wooden Bedroom Furniture from the People's Republic of China

Requestor: AP Industries; convertible cribs (model nos. 1000-0100; 
1000-0125; 1000-0160; 1000-1195/2195; 1000-2145; and 1000-2165) are not 
within the scope of the antidumping duty order; April 30, 2008.

A-570-891: Hand Trucks from the People's Republic of China

Requestor: WelCom Products, Inc.; its MCX Magna Cart is not within the 
scope of the antidumping duty order; May 12, 2008.

A-570-898: Chlorinated Isocyanurates from the People's Republic of 
China

Requestor: BioLab, Inc.; chlorinated isocyanurates originating in the 
People's Republic of China, that are packaged, tableted, blended with 
additives, or otherwise further processed in Canada by Capo Industries, 
Ltd., before entering the U.S., are within the scope of the antidumping 
duty order; April 9, 2008.

A-570-899: Artist Canvas from the People's Republic of China

Requestor: Tara Materials, Inc.; artist canvas purchased in the U.S. 
that has been woven, primed with gesso, and cut to size in the U.S. and 
shipped to the PRC for assembling (i.e., wrapping and stapling to the 
wooden frame) and returned to the U.S. are not within the scope of the 
antidumping duty order; April 10, 2008.

Multiple Countries

A-549-821: Polyethylene Retail Carrier Bags from Thailand; A-557-813: 
Polyethylene Retail Carrier Bags from Malaysia; A-570-886: Polyethylene 
Retail Carrier Bags from the People's Republic of China

Requestor: Medline Industries, Inc.; certain hospital patient 
belongings bags and surgical kit bags (drawstring bags model nos. 
DS500C, DS400C, 38667, 25117, 28614, and 42817) are within the scope of 
the antidumping duty orders; certain hospital patient belongings bags 
and surgical kit bags (drawstring bags model nos. DONDS600, 7510, 
42818, and rigid handle bag model no. 26900)

[[Page 49419]]

are not within the scope of the antidumping duty orders; May 8, 2008.
